BENEFITS PROGRAM

We provide competitive and comprehensive benefits programs, tailored to each part of the globe our people work in. From walking and fitness challenges to volunteer experiences, flexible work environments, generous leave programs and retirement plan options, we offer ways to support you in every stage of living your best life.

Company Paid Basic Life & AD&D Insurance

Company Paid Short-Term Disability

Voluntary Long-Term Disability Insurance

Robust Wellness Program with incentives available to save money on your medical insurance premiums.

Supplemental Life; Accident; Cancer; Critical Illness; Identity Theft Protection and Legal Coverage

Three medical plan offerings including a High Deductible Health Plan, HMO plan (available in select states) and a Co-Pay medical plan.

Health Savings Account (HSA) with company core contribution and match, on a per pay period basis if enrolled in the HDHP medical plan.

Flexible Spending Accounts

Dependent Care Savings Account.

Dental Insurance Plan

Vision Insurance Plan

9 Company Paid Holidays including the day after Thanksgiving.

Generous paid time off programs for vacation and sick days

Employee Assistance Plan with access to Talk Space Therapy

Family Medical Leave

Paid Parental Leave (4 weeks)

Maternity benefits utilizing company paid STD, plus Parental Leave (4 weeks) to provide time for recovery, baby bonding, and enjoying your family time.

Bereavement Leave

401(k) Retirement Plan with a generous match per pay period

Student Loan Payment Match
